prep and Cook Time
- Preparation: 10 minutes
- Cooking: 15 minutes
- Total Time: 25 minutes
Yield
Serves 2 hearty portions
Difficulty Level
Easy – perfect for weekday breakfasts or cozy weekend brunches
Ingredients
- 1 cup rolled oats (old-fashioned for ideal texture)
- 1 3/4 cups milk (dairy or unsweetened almond milk)
- 1/2 cup freshly grated carrots (about 1 medium carrot)
- 2 tablespoons maple syrup (or honey, for natural sweetness)
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
- 1/4 teaspoon ground ginger
- 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
- Pinch of salt
- 1 ounce chopped walnuts or pecans (optional, for crunch)
- For the Cream Cheese Swirl:
- 4 ounces cream cheese, softened
- 2 tablespoons Greek yogurt or sour cream
- 2 tablespoons powdered sugar
- 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
Instructions
- Prepare the cream cheese swirl: In a small bowl, combine the softened cream cheese, Greek yogurt, powdered sugar, and vanilla extract. Whisk until smooth and creamy. Set aside while preparing the oatmeal.
- Cook the oats: In a medium saucepan, bring the milk to a gentle simmer over medium heat. Stir in the rolled oats, grated carrots, maple syrup, cinnamon, nutmeg, ginger, vanilla extract, and a pinch of salt.
- simmer gently: Reduce the heat to low and cook the oatmeal, stirring occasionally, until thickened and creamy, about 10-12 minutes. Stir frequently near the end to prevent sticking and ensure even cooking.
- Add nuts: Just before finishing, fold in the chopped walnuts or pecans for a delightful textural contrast.
- Assemble the bowl: Divide the hot carrot cake oatmeal between two bowls. Using a spoon, dollop generous swirls of the cream cheese mixture over the top. Gently swirl it into the oats for creamy pockets of indulgence.
- Garnish and serve: Sprinkle additional chopped nuts and a light dusting of cinnamon on top. For an elegant touch, add a thin carrot ribbon or a small sprig of fresh mint.
tips for Success
- Consistency matters: If you prefer your oatmeal thicker, reduce the milk slightly, or cook it a bit longer. for a creamier texture, stir gently but consistently to avoid lumps.
- Grate carrots finely: Using a microplane grater will help the carrots soften quickly inside the oatmeal, blending naturally without overwhelming texture.
- Sweetener adjustments: Maple syrup enhances the warm spice profile, but honey or coconut sugar are lovely alternatives for subtle differences.
- Make-ahead option: Prepare the cream cheese swirl a day before and store it in an airtight container. Rewarm the oatmeal gently and swirl before serving.
- Nut-free variation: omit the nuts and substitute with toasted sunflower seeds or pumpkin seeds for crunch without allergens.

Q4: Can I prepare this recipe ahead of time?
A4: Absolutely! You can prep the oats and shredded carrots the night before. Store them in the fridge and reheat gently in the morning, adding the cream cheese swirl just before serving for maximum creaminess. It’s a fantastic grab-and-go option for busy mornings without sacrificing flavor or nutrition.
Q5: Is this recipe suitable for special diets?
A5: This carrot cake oatmeal is naturally vegetarian and can easily be adapted for gluten-free diets by using certified gluten-free oats. For a vegan version, swap cream cheese with a plant-based alternative and use your favorite non-dairy milk. The recipe’s versatility means everyone can enjoy this sweet start!
